If you discover that you are losing your hair, whether you are male or female, young or old, then you need to take action, and usually the first thing to do is to book an appointment with your health care provider. There may be some medical reasons to explain your hair loss, and it is as well to check these possibilities out first. For example, thyroid issues can lead to hair loss, and if this is the case, it may be possible to easily reverse your hair loss once your thyroid becomes balanced, but this won’t happen unless you get tested!

Medical hair restoration takes healthy hair from one part of the body and transplants it to your thinning or balding areas. Once the medical hair restoration procedure has been completed, your hair will look natural, because it is! However, you do need to make sure that you go to a reputable company, one that can give you good references, references who you can perhaps even talk to to get their input as to what to expect.
